BCLS Acquisition (BLSA) currently reports a total liabilities of $5.8M as of June 2022. That compares with $5.3M in the prior-year period — up 10.2% year over year. Use the charts on this page to explore BCLS Acquisition's total liabilities history and peer comparisons.
